My First Plaque

Hi everyone, I expect you're surprised to see me posting when it's not a SNS day aren't you?

I'm sorry that I haven't been about for such a long time, but we still have so much work to do on the new house and apart from my DT cards, I've only been managing to get family and friend cards made and haven't had time to do much of anything else. However, all that changed this week.
Ages ago, I bought some MDF blanks from Joanna Sheen and I've been trying to decide what to do with them ever since (typical of me!)
I finally decided to make a plaque for my craft room door and I'm really pleased with how it's turned out, especially as it's my first attempt and I'm absolutely useless at making projects.


 In case any of you are interested in how I made it, here is a little resume:
Firstly, I lightly sanded the plaque and then painted it with a matchpot in 'Ivory' once it was dry I swiped over the whole thing with 'Antique Linen' and 'Vintage Photo' Distress Pads.
The little frame was made from Capricious Scraps 'Spontaneous Delight' kit and the text was done on my PC. For the image I used the sweet 'Krafty Kate' from Saturated Canary and flipped it so I had a mirror image too.
The flowers are from my stash and they and the images were coloured with Promarkers. I finally added the pearls, flower centres and some garden string to hang it from and that's it!

I really enjoyed making this and as I have some little MDF hearts I may have a go at those next (I know, the best laid plans etc.) I thought maybe if I stamped them with angels or something I could use them for the christmas tree this year.
I'll let you know how it goes!
